Shakespeare (1564-1616) wrote 154 sonnets, which were published 1609 in âSHAKESPEAREâS Sonnets Never before Imprintedâ. The first 126 sonnets address a young man and the relationship to the speaker. Furthermore, the sonnets 1-17 are called âprocreation sonnetsâ. There have been made several attempts in order find out the real identity of the âyoung manâ in Shakespearâs sonnets but any historical equivalents have still not been proved...
